1、Gamma函数:

Gamma函数matlab代码:

x=:0.5:5
syms t
y=int(t.^(x-)*exp(-t),,inf)
y=double(y)
plot(x,y,'r-o','linewidth',)

图像如下:

2、lgΓ(x)函数

matlab代码:

x=:0.1:5
syms t
y=int(t.^(x-)*exp(-t),,inf)
y=log10(double(y))
plot(x,y,'r-o','linewidth',)

图形:

Gamma分布:

matlab代码:

a=,b=0.5
syms c
d=int(c^(a-)*exp(-c),,inf)
t=:0.1:
g=b.^a*(t.^(a-)).*exp(-b*t)/d
g=double(g)
plot(t,g,'r-.','linewidth',)

图形:

matlab代码:

t=:0.1:
syms c a=,b=0.5
d=int(c^(a-)*exp(-c),,inf)
g=b.^a*(t.^(a-)).*exp(-b*t)/d
g=double(g)
plot(t,g,'r-.','linewidth',)
hold on;
a=,b=0.5
d=int(c^(a-)*exp(-c),,inf)
g=b.^a*(t.^(a-)).*exp(-b*t)/d
g=double(g)
plot(t,g,'g-.','linewidth',)
hold on
a=,b=0.5
d=int(c^(a-)*exp(-c),,inf)
g=b.^a*(t.^(a-)).*exp(-b*t)/d
g=double(g)
plot(t,g,'b-.','linewidth',)
hold on
a=,b=
d=int(c^(a-)*exp(-c),,inf)
g=b.^a*(t.^(a-)).*exp(-b*t)/d
g=double(g)
plot(t,g,'c-.','linewidth',)
hold on
a=,b=
d=int(c^(a-)*exp(-c),,inf)
g=b.^a*(t.^(a-)).*exp(-b*t)/d
g=double(g)
plot(t,g,'m-.','linewidth',)
hold on;
legend('a=1,b=0.5','a=2,b=0.5','a=3,b=0.5','a=5,b=1','a=9,b=2');

图形:

Gamma函数相关matlab代码的更多相关文章

  1. 如何加速MATLAB代码运行

    学习笔记 V1.0 2015/4/17 如何加速MATLAB代码运行 概述 本文源于LDPCC的MATLAB代码,即<CCSDS标准的LDPC编译码仿真>.由于代码的问题,在信息位长度很长 ...

  2. 多分类问题中,实现不同分类区域颜色填充的MATLAB代码(demo:Random Forest)

    之前建立了一个SVM-based Ordinal regression模型,一种特殊的多分类模型,就想通过可视化的方式展示模型分类的效果,对各个分类区域用不同颜色表示.可是,也看了很多代码,但基本都是 ...

  3. 卷积相关公式的matlab代码

    取半径=3 用matlab代码实现上式公式: length=3;for Ki = 1:length for Kj = 1:length for Kk = 1:length Ksigma(Ki,Kj,K ...

  4. JAVA调用matlab代码

    做实验一直用的matlab代码,需要嵌入到java项目中,matlab代码拼拼凑凑不是很了解,投机取巧采用java调用matlab的方式解决. 1.    matlab版本:matlabR2014a ...

  5. 调试和运行matlab代码(源程序)的技巧和教程

    转载请标明出处:专注matlab代码下载的网站http://www.downma.com/ 本文主要给大家分享使用matlab编写代码,完成课程设计.毕业设计或者研究项目时,matlab调试程序的技巧 ...

  6. 直方图均衡化与Matlab代码实现

    昨天说了,今天要好好的来解释说明一下直方图均衡化.并且通过不调用histeq函数来实现直方图的均衡化. 一.直方图均衡化概述 直方图均衡化(Histogram Equalization) 又称直方图平 ...

  7. 将labelme 生成的.json文件进行可视化的代码+label.png 对比度处理的matlab代码

    labelme_to_dataset 指令的代码实现: show.py文件 #!E:\Anaconda3\python.exe import argparse import json import o ...

  8. SVM实例及Matlab代码

    ******************************************************** ***数据集下载地址 :http://pan.baidu.com/s/1geb8CQf ...

  9. Latex中Matlab代码的环境

    需要用到listings宏包 使用方法: 导言区\usepackage{listings}\lstset{language=Matlab}      %代码语言使用的是matlab\lstset{br ...

随机推荐

  1. hdu 3047 Zjnu Stadium 并查集高级应用

    Zjnu Stadium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others) Tot ...

  2. golang 热更新技巧 负载均衡才是正道啊

    golang plugin热更新尝试 - 呵大官人的鱼塘 - 开源中国 https://my.oschina.net/scgywx/blog/1796358 golang plugin热更新尝试 发布 ...

  3. 微信公众号 待发货-物流中-已收货 foreach break continue

    w <?php $warr = array(1,2,3); $w_break = 0; foreach($warr AS $w){ if($w==2)break; $w_break += $w; ...

  4. 码云平台, 生成并部署SSH key

    参考链接: http://git.mydoc.io/?t=154712 步骤如下: 1. 生成 sshkey: ssh-keygen -t rsa -C "xxxxx@xxxxx.com&q ...

  5. [荐][转]为何应该使用 MacOS X(论GUI环境下开发人员对软件的配置与重用)

    一周前我和 Tinyfool 闲聊苹果操作系统,都认为对于开发人员来说,苹果操作系统(MacOS)是上佳的选择.Tinyfool 笔头很快,当即就写了一篇长文章,我则笔头很慢,今天才全部码好.他的文章 ...

  6. 转!java自定义注解

    转自:http://blog.csdn.net/yixiaogang109/article/details/7328466  Java注解是附加在代码中的一些元信息,用于一些工具在编译.运行时进行解析 ...

  7. django-admin详细设置

    Django自带的后台管理是Django明显特色之一,可以让我们快速便捷管理数据.后台管理可以在各个app的admin.py文件中进行控制.以下是我最近摸索总结出比较实用的配置.若你有什么比较好的配置 ...

  8. 【Navicat连接Oracle数据库】-Navicat连接Oracle数据库设置

    1.navicat连接数据配置信息如下图所示:   点击"确定"按钮,进入到软件   按照图中所画的步骤顺序操作,最后重新启动navicat就可. 关于里面的这个文件夹 insta ...

  9. centos上源码安装clang 3.8

    之前想在centos系统上安装clang 3.6版本,由于yum上版本太低,想通过源码编译安装.按照网上说的源码安装步骤,下好llvm.clang.clang-tools-extra和compiler ...

  10. Spark生态系统剖析--王家林老师